The OEM is responsible for creating and securing the BIOS or firmware update itself. Microsoft’s role is in the Windows-side delivery and trust chain, not in authoring the firmware payload.
For firmware updates delivered through Windows Update:
- OEM/IHV responsibility
- The firmware update is delivered as a driver package.
- That package must pass Windows HLK testing and be submitted to Partner Center for signing.
- The OEM/IHV is responsible for the integrity and security of the firmware itself, including signature verification, encryption, or other protections.
- Firmware defaults stored in device firmware are maintained by the OEM.
- Microsoft responsibility
- Windows uses the signed driver package to verify integrity before handing the firmware payload to UEFI.
- Secure Boot and some certificate updates can be applied through Windows Update.
- Microsoft can also pause offering an update to affected devices when compatibility issues are identified.
Based on that, the responsibility is effectively both, but in different parts of the process:
- Approving/publishing the firmware package for Windows Update delivery: the OEM prepares and submits the update package; Microsoft provides the signing and Windows Update delivery path.
- Authoring and validating the BIOS update itself: the OEM.
- Withdrawing or stopping broad Windows Update offering after an issue is found: Microsoft can pause the offering, and OEMs are involved in investigation and remediation.
For a known critical issue such as a BitLocker recovery loop:
- The context shows that when startup failures were linked to third-party firmware on specific models, Microsoft paused the offering of the update to affected devices.
- The same context also states that the issue could only be addressed with firmware updates provided by the device manufacturer.
So the practical split is:
- Microsoft can stop or pause further Windows Update distribution to prevent more devices from being affected.
- The OEM is responsible for producing the corrected firmware update.
For Windows IoT Enterprise scheduling:
The context does not provide a product-specific statement about whether Windows IoT Enterprise receives OEM BIOS updates on a Microsoft-controlled schedule versus an OEM-controlled schedule. The supported facts are only that:
- Firmware updates are packaged and signed like driver packages for Windows delivery.
- Availability through Windows Update can differ from vendor tools because the vendor or OEM determines the availability of their updates.
That supports only this conclusion: the OEM determines update availability, while Microsoft provides the Windows Update distribution mechanism.
